Definition

A low-calorie vinaigrette-style dressing, typically vinegar-based with herbs and spices, designed to emulate traditional Italian dressing without added fats.

Sensory Profile

TasteTangy, acidic, herbaceous, sweet (from added sugars/sweeteners), savory
TextureThin, watery, light viscosity
AromaVinegar, garlic, oregano, basil
AcidityHigh

Chef’s Secret

For a quick, flavorful nonfat dressing, whisk together red wine vinegar, minced garlic, dried oregano, a pinch of sugar, and salt and pepper.

Substitutions

Best Match

Light Vinaigrette

1:1

A good general light dressing option with a similar acidic and herbal profile.

Red Wine Vinegar + Herbs

1:1

Homemade alternative, allows control over sweetness and salt, provides the core acidic flavor.

Balsamic Vinaigrette (light)

1:1

Offers a sweeter, richer tang but a different flavor profile than traditional Italian.

Lemon Juice + Herbs

1:1

Provides acidity and freshness, but lacks the depth of vinegar-based dressings.

Buying Guide

Check sugar content, as nonfat dressings often compensate with extra sweeteners. Look for natural ingredients.
